Output 4fc8d2bcd047989cb7f780106b11bc4a243d991cab5d963f210b3fd87ffeb1ec:2

value
521078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b956714e695edbf978291d5dacea7e5018e46a5e OP_EQUAL
address
3JazVAoAfXTZvsLiGYNhxGQmCwP2QyQLtb
transaction
4fc8d2bcd047989cb7f780106b11bc4a243d991cab5d963f210b3fd87ffeb1ec
spent
true